Lat. \L.¥x. comparer, compoir.] In old English practice. To appear; closely rendered in the Scotch law, to compear, Comparet; he appears. Bract. fol.

334 b.

Comperuit; he appeared. See Comperuit ad diem. Coihparebit; he shall appear.

Reg, Orig. 291 b. Comparuerit.

Bract, fol.

365. Comparuisset. Reg. Jwd. 5.

Comparentibus; appearing. Bract, fol.

183 b, 372 b.

Cum partes injudicio comparuerint; when the parties have appeared in court. Id. fol.

296 b.
